What is the Wynwood Art District?
Wynwood is a Miami neighborhood north of downtown known for its outdoor murals and street art, centered on the Wynwood Walls and surrounding warehouse blocks.

Is Wynwood a good location for engagement photos?
It offers a walkable backdrop of murals, graffiti, and large-scale art, and because the walls are repainted over time, sessions there rarely look alike.
